How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 78724?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 78724 Studio Apartments | $1,165 | $858 | $1,703 |
| 78724 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,411 | $423 | $2,746 |
| 78724 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,775 | $423 | $4,842 |
| 78724 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,028 | $1,097 | $3,625 |
| 78724 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,237 | $1,549 | $11,186 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om the 78724 ZIP Code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in 78724 with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in 78724 is at Urbana at Hioaks listed at $1,601.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om 78724 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in 78724 is $2,028.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om 78724 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in 78724 is a 1,390 square feet unit starting from $2,089 at Village at West Lake.
